Toronto grabbed a quick lead then had to fight to retain its advantage before securing a 28-20 win against Richmond Edison in an Ohio high school football matchup on Sept. 22.
Toronto opened with a 14-0 advantage over Richmond Edison through the first quarter.
The roles reversed in the second quarter as the Wildcats fought to 14-7.
Toronto darted to a 20-7 lead heading into the fourth quarter.
The Wildcats rallied in the fourth quarter, but the Red Knights skirted trouble with just enough offense to thwart all hopes.
